The cheapest way to get from North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ake is to drive which costs $70 - $110 and takes 4h 34m.
The fastest way to get from North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ake is to ferry and fly which takes 2h 37m and costs $100 - $480.
No, there is no direct bus from North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ake. However, there are services departing from Lonsdale Quay and arriving at Bernard Ave at Richter St via Vancouver, BC - Pacific Central Station and Queensway Exchange Bay J.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 6m.
The distance between North Vancouver and Okanagan Lake is 279 km. The road distance is 369.7 km.
The best way to get from North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ake without a car is to ferry and bus which takes 6h 39m and costs .
It takes approximately 2h 37m to get from North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ake, including transfers.
North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ake bus services, operated by EBus Canada, depart from Vancouver, BC - Pacific Central Station.
North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ake bus services, operated by EBus Canada, arrive at Kelowna, BC - Downtown station.
Yes, the driving distance between North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ake is 370 km. It takes approximately 4h 34m to drive from North Vancouver to Okanagan Lake.

What companies run services between North Vancouver, BC, Canada and Okanagan Lake, BC, Canada?
EBus Canada operates a bus from Vancouver, BC - Pacific Central Station to Kelowna, BC - Downtown twice daily, and the journey takes 5h 25m. Red Arrow also services this route 4 times a week.
